  • Check or Uncheck a messageCheckbox field depending on a LOV field value

    Dear Gurus,
    Please let me know if we can check or uncheck a check box field based on a value in LOV field in a OAF Page. I need to know if we can do this without touching the code in controller, is it possible? Please provide your valuable thoughts.
    The requirement is something like say, if X is a value in LOV, we need to check the checkbox else we need to uncheck the checkbox
    Thanks in Advance,
    Affy

    You could try workaround. Not sure whether this is feasible in your case.
    You need to modify (add a new column) the LOV query something like this :
    select decode(<column_name>, 'X','Y','N') checkbox_value,
    from .....
    where ....
    Make sure that the checkbox checked value = 'Y' and unchecked value = 'N'.
    Set this attribute as the return item to the checkbox.
    Cheers
    AJ

  • How to show an error if the user enters a value which is not in the dropdown of a form

    Hi All,
    I have attached the screenshot below and if we look at the field for claimnumber we have a dropdown which can help the users pick the available claimnumbers, but if someone accidentally types in a claimnumber that is not in the system( which doesnt show
    up in the dropdown) the form is accepting that claimnumbers too, but i want to have a error or warning window popup saying that this claimnumber is not valid or something.
    Can someone please help me with this?
    Thanks.

    Open the form in design view.
    Select the Combo Box.
    Set its Limit to List property to Yes.
    If the user types a value that does not occur in the list, Access will display a standard error message:
    If you want to display a custom message, you can write code in the On Not in List
    event of the combo box:
    Private Sub ClaimNumber_NotInList(NewData As String, Response As Integer)
    ' Undo the incorrect item
    Me.ClaimNumber.Undo
    ' Display a custom error message
    MsgBox "Please select a claim number from the list!", vbExclamation
    ' Tell Access not to display the built-in message
    Response = acDataErrContinue
    End Sub
    where ClaimNumber is the name of the combo box.
    Regards, Hans Vogelaar (http://www.eileenslounge.com)

  • How do I populate form fields depending on the value of a list box?

    Hi,
    Can anybody help me out here?
    I'm creating a form where I'm needing to populate a number of fields (first name & last name) based on the value of a list box (values are 1,2,3,4,5,6) ie: if 3 is selected 3 sets of the first name and last name fields populate on the page for the user to fill out.
    At this stage it is just a prototype site and there is no database running behind it.
    Thanks
    Hayden

    This can only be solved if you have javascript coding skills.  Without knowing more about what you want to do and why, I can only show you a skeleton of how your code should look, but consider this form select field -
    <select onchange="populateForm()">
    When a value is selected from that list, the "onchange" event will fire, and will call the javascript function called populateForm().  You need to define a function by that name somewhere on the page -
    <script type="text/javascript">
    //<![CDATA[
    function populateForm(value) {
         if value >0 { document.getElementById("fieldID").style.display='block' }
         if value >1 { .... }
         etc.
    //]]>
    </script>
    The page itself would need to have ALL the fields already in the form, but with those that are to be revealed set to a style of display:none.
    Obviously, this is a skinny skeleton.  Each test in the function would reveal a new field on the page by changing its display style from "none" (which is how they should be set in the code) to "block".  You would need a separate function for each type of field that might need to be chosen.
    If this is well over your head, then I'm afraid you will be out of luck for this particular approach....
